Description

Betelgeuse is the brightest Red Supergiant (RSG) in the sky and thus has been studied over decades. Photometrically, a funda-
mental pulsation mode (FM) at a period P ≈400 d and a long, secondary period (LSP) with still disputed origin at P ≈2400 d have
been found. The Leibniz Institute for Astrophysics Potsdam (AIP) monitors Betelgeuse almost nightly since more than a decade
with its robotic spectroscopic telescope STELLA, collecting R≈55000 spectra covering wavelength ranges from 390-860 nm.
This proceeding reports about radial-velocity data, periods found within and their connection to photometric measurements.
